Digestive Components in Brown Rice That May Cause Gas
Brown rice contains several components that can contribute to increased gas production in some individuals. One of the primary factors is the presence of dietary fiber, particularly insoluble fiber, which is more abundant in brown rice than in white rice due to the intact bran layer. While fiber is beneficial for digestive health, it is also fermented by gut bacteria in the large intestine, producing gases such as hydrogen, methane, and carbon dioxide as byproducts.
Another significant element is resistant starch, which resists digestion in the small intestine and reaches the colon where it undergoes fermentation. This fermentation process can lead to gas production and bloating in sensitive individuals. Additionally, brown rice contains certain oligosaccharides—complex carbohydrates that are not fully digested by human enzymes but fermented by intestinal bacteria, contributing to flatulence.
The following factors in brown rice can influence its gas-producing potential:
- Insoluble Fiber: Stimulates bowel movements but can increase fermentation.
- Resistant Starch: Acts as a prebiotic but may cause gas.
- Oligosaccharides: Poorly digested carbohydrates that ferment in the gut.
Understanding these components helps explain why some people may experience gas after consuming brown rice, especially if their gut microbiome is not accustomed to high-fiber foods.
Individual Differences in Gas Production from Brown Rice
Gas production varies significantly among individuals due to differences in gut microbiota composition, digestive enzyme activity, and overall diet. Some people have a gut microbiome that efficiently ferments fiber and resistant starch without excessive gas, while others may experience discomfort and bloating.
Factors influencing individual responses include:
- Gut Microbiome Diversity: A richer and more balanced microbiota tends to handle fiber better.
- Enzyme Levels: Variations in digestive enzymes can affect carbohydrate breakdown.
- Dietary Habits: Sudden increases in fiber intake can lead to temporary gas.
- Underlying Digestive Conditions: Conditions like irritable bowel syndrome (IBS) can heighten gas sensitivity.
To minimize gas production, individuals may gradually increase brown rice consumption to allow the gut microbiome to adapt or combine it with other foods that aid digestion.
Comparison of Gas Potential in Different Types of Rice
Different rice varieties vary in their fiber and carbohydrate composition, affecting their potential to cause gas. Brown rice, being a whole grain, contains more fiber and resistant starch compared to white rice, which has been milled and polished to remove the bran and germ layers. Parboiled rice also differs in fiber content and digestibility due to its processing method.
| Rice Type | Fiber Content (per 100g cooked) | Resistant Starch Level | Gas Production Potential |
|---|---|---|---|
| Brown Rice | 1.8 g | Moderate to High | Higher |
| White Rice | 0.3 g | Low | Lower |
| Parboiled Rice | 0.9 g | Moderate | Moderate |
This comparison highlights that brown rice has a greater potential to cause gas due to its higher fiber and resistant starch content. However, individual tolerance plays a critical role in actual digestive symptoms.
Strategies to Reduce Gas When Eating Brown Rice
To minimize the likelihood of experiencing gas after consuming brown rice, several strategies can be employed:
- Gradual : Slowly increase brown rice intake to allow the gut microbiota to adapt.
- Soaking and Rinsing: Soaking rice before cooking can reduce oligosaccharide content.
- Proper Cooking: Cooking rice thoroughly can help break down some fibers.
- Combining with Digestive Aids: Eating brown rice with ginger, fennel, or probiotics may improve digestion.
- Hydration: Drinking sufficient water aids fiber digestion and reduces gas buildup.
Incorporating these practices can help individuals enjoy the nutritional benefits of brown rice while minimizing digestive discomfort.
